<br />('i ("', 4) <br />,:,) .j '....I <br /> <br />THURSDAY <br /> <br />SEPTEMBER 20, 1979 <br /> <br />The regular semi-monthly meeting of the Council of the City of Martinsville, Virginia, <br /> <br />with Mayor William D. Hobson presiding, was held on Thursday, September 20, 1979, in the <br /> <br />Council Chamber, City Hall, beginning at 7:30 p.m., the September 20th date having been <br /> <br />previously established as a variation from the regularly scheduled meeting which would <br /> <br />have normally been held on September 25th. All members of Council were present, namely, <br /> <br />William D. Hobson, Mayor; William C. Cole, Jr., Vice Mayor; Barry A. Greene; L. D. Oakes; <br /> <br />and Francis T. West. <br /> <br />Following the invocation, Council approved as recorded the minutes of its regular meeting <br /> <br />held on September II, 1979. <br /> <br />In the interest of the Western Virginia Emergency Medical Services Council, Ms. Kathryn P. <br /> <br />Miller, Executive Director thereof, appeared before Council to explain the Medical Services <br /> <br />Council's activities and objectives and requested City Council to officially endorse the work <br /> <br />of the group, which hopes to secure a Federal grant which would be used to make a feasibility <br /> <br />study towards implementing a more comprehensive emergency medical service system in this <br /> <br />region. There was specific discussion on the role of the local volunteer emergency services <br /> <br />group, in relation to the regional council and its activities, and various questions were <br /> <br />raised and discussed. Following the discussion, Council was in unanimous approval of improved <br /> <br />emergency services for the area.
